Revert "Increase internal clock resolution to nsec" This reverts fd784ccaf649128965be016f857708669e798479 commit. Thanks Stephen, but actually I think the last patch (increase clock resolution) shouldn't go in yet. I'm not done yet looking at all the compatibility issues and it does change the range of valid values for everything dealing with times. Most places I looked at still accept reasonable ranges, but I would feel more comfortable to make sure everything is fine first.
